Modèle:Ref label/Documentation
From Wikipedia, the free encyclopedia
L'utilisation des balises <ref> n'est pas le seul moyen pour créer des notes en bas de pages.
Style alternatif
Le système <ref> et <references/> de Cite.php est un style pour les sources bibliographiques. Pour plus de détails sur ce système, veuillez vous reporter à Aide:Note ou Wikipédia:Citez vos sources.
Utilisation
Ce modèle doit être utilisé uniquement si les balises <ref></ref> sont inefficaces.
Ce modèle, utilisé conjointement avec {{note label}}, permet de créer un système d'ancres de même nature mais parallèle au système de références créé avec les balises <ref></ref>. Ainsi, le modèle {{Ref label}} n'est pas affecté par la balise <references />.
Syntaxe
Cas simple
- Les syntaxes
{{ref label|XXX|A|none}},{{ref label|YYZ|B|none}}, etc. (autant que voulu) se placent dans le corps du texte. Le texte de la note ne se place qu'après les ancres{{note label|XXX}},{{note label|YYZ}}, etc. (autant d'ancres note label que d'ancres ref label) qui elles-mêmes sont groupées à la fin de la discussion, du modèle, ... sous forme de liste à l'aide des balises html habituelles. Dans ce cas simple les modèles {{refl}}/{{refa}} sont préférés.
{{note label|nom_de_la_référence_D|label|none}}
- Ajout d'une {{note label}} pour que notre exemple ait au moins une étiquette à suivre : « ^ ». SVP corriger si ce n'est pas bon : c'est quand même mieux que d'avoir un exemple qui ne fonctionne pas.
- Voici ensuite un exemple de {{ref label}} qui pointera vers le {{note label}} qu'on vient tout juste d'ajouter.
Machin{{ref label|nom_de_la_référence_D|label|none}} truc.
- Machin[label] truc.
Cas complexe
Lorsqu'une syntaxe {{ref label|XXX|A|... apparaît plusieurs fois pour la même note, le dernier paramètre permet de les différencier (il s'agit de leur identifiant).
Machin{{ref label|nom_de_la_référence_D|label|id1}}
Wagon{{ref label|nom_de_la_référence_D|label|id2}}
Paramètres
- 1 = nom de la référence – nom de la référence (obligatoire); exemple: ZXW
- 2 = label – label du lien retour cliquable (obligatoire); exemple: A
- 3 = identifiant ou id; (facultatif) exemple: a